Why warehouse layout planning matters on the Aero Ultra
Fast movers belong within a short walk of the packing bench.
A written internal standard for warehouse layout planning makes onboarding new account managers far quicker and reduces avoidable errors.
Clear aisle and bay labelling reduces training time for temporary staff.

Checklist
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.

Frequently asked questions
How should Aero Ultra stock be laid out?
Fast movers near packing, slow movers higher or further away, and a physically separate quarantine area.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
